Alexander Hubmer is a scholar working on Radiological and Ultrasound Technology, Global and Planetary Change and Radiation. According to data from OpenAlex, Alexander Hubmer has authored 30 papers receiving a total of 522 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Radiological and Ultrasound Technology, 20 papers in Global and Planetary Change and 4 papers in Radiation. Recurrent topics in Alexander Hubmer's work include Radioactivity and Radon Measurements (20 papers), Radioactive contamination and transfer (20 papers) and Radioactive element chemistry and processing (4 papers). Alexander Hubmer is often cited by papers focused on Radioactivity and Radon Measurements (20 papers), Radioactive contamination and transfer (20 papers) and Radioactive element chemistry and processing (4 papers). Alexander Hubmer collaborates with scholars based in Austria, Italy and Belgium. Alexander Hubmer's co-authors include H. Lettner, Peter Bossew, Friedrich Steinhäusler, W. Hofmann, Anton Hermann, Barbara Krammer, Martin H. Gerzabek, Birgit Sattler, Peter Höfer and F. Strebl and has published in prestigious journals such as Environment International, International Journal of Environmental Research and Public Health and Photochemistry and Photobiology.
